Installation of the 303 JUG Horse Stall Waterer
when not using 303 Riser Tubes.
When a 303 is not mounted on top of a 303 Riser Tube it will be necessary to “Field Drill” the hole in
the JUG that will accommodate the incoming waterline. The proper size hole (the size of your
incoming water line) can be drilled in the back area of the JUG. This is the area that is not part of
the water reservoir. The water line can enter the JUG through the top or the bottom. The size of the
incoming water line will then need to be adapted to the 1/2 inch 303 shut off valve that is mounted
inside the Service Tunnel of the 303.

Flushing The Water Line
Remove the Front Half Float Valve by turning it counter
clockwise 1/4 turn and pulling it out of the Float Valve Base,
as shown on the following page. Turn on the incoming
water supply and let it run freely for a few minutes. The
water reservoir will need to be drained away at this time by
removing the External Drain Plug. Turn the water off and
reinstall the Front Half Float Valve and the External Drain
Plug. Turn the water back on.
Final Installation Steps
After connecting the power to the Heater and Thermostat, (see wiring diagram on following pages).
Install the 303 JUG Lid.
***Be careful not to cross thread the bolts as they are turned into the brass inserts.***
Turn the water on and fill the reservoir to the desired level. You can adjust this by turning the
External Adjustment Shaft. Ideally the water level out in the drinking bowl will be 1/2 inch above the
highest part (back side) of the drinking hole.
Installation of the 303 JUG Horse Stall Waterer
when using 303 Riser Tubes
Insert the 1/2 inch X 1/2 inch Hose Barb/Elbow into the incoming 1/2 inch waterline and secure with
a hose clamp. (If you are not using a standard 1/2 inch waterline to supply the 303 Jug, you will
need to provide your own Barb/Elbow fitting components.) Using thread sealant, attach the
enclosed Brass Nipple to the incoming Barb/Elbow. Attach the 1/2 inch end of the enclosed 303
flex hose to the incoming Brass Nipple and tighten securely. Gently ease the Flex Hose up into the
Service Tunnel of the 303 as you slide the fountain on the riser tube. Attach the small fitting on the
other end of the 303 Flex Hose to the threaded Brass Elbow coming out of the end of the 303 Shut
Off Valve, and tighten securely. When the water line has been properly flushed and checked for
leaks, and the electricity (if with heat) has been properly hooked up, and the 303 has been
mounted to the wall, pump sealant between the outside of the riser tube and the 4 inch hole on the
bottom of the 303 to create a good weather seal.

Flat Back 303: “Field Drill” 6 holes in the back wall of the Flat Back 303.
The holes should be drilled in such places so that when lag bolts with
washers are placed through them that they will attach to the strongest
points of the wall available. Use whatever length of Lag Bolts fit your
specific mounting situation.
